Safety interlock
z
Four opening elem. (e.g. push-buttons) are required.
z
After an opening element (A1) or (B1) has been actuated. The respective door is opened and
closed again after the hold-open time has expired. In order to open the second door, another
opening element (A2) or (B2) must be operated within the interlock.

Hospital interlock
z
Only two opening elements are required.
z
Softswitch no. 16 must be positioned on OFF.
z
After an opening element (A) or (B) has been activated, the respective door is opened and
closed again after the hold-open time has expired; then the second door is opened without any
actuation of an opening element.
z
For safety reasons at least one opening element (C) must nevertheless be installed within the
interlock area.

5.7Infrared light detectors fault
If the installation is open when the premises close, because the infrared light detectors are
interrupted, the door will close nonetheless at slow speed when the system is switched to the
program position NIGHT, in spite of the fault.
